Output 31aa7eb3bebf16df10a2551a0a228c4371114c3a7586abec88e4b80f32212717:17

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c3255ffc0a620777f453b5ca9b0bbb05fd80cb4 OP_EQUALVERIFY OP_CHECKSIG
address
16VHqutLqJmR1GC5gj6eytAp2QYV5aCRVR
transaction
31aa7eb3bebf16df10a2551a0a228c4371114c3a7586abec88e4b80f32212717
confirmations
530774
spent
true